Simpson delivers baby girl, Maxwell

From Wire Reports

The Jessica Simpson baby watch is finally over.

Simpson gave birth to a daughter named Maxwell Drew Johnson in Los Angeles on Tuesday, said publicist Lauren Auslander. Maxwell weighed 9 pounds, 13 ounces.

Since announcing her pregnancy last Halloween over Twitter, Simpson posed nude for the cover of Elle magazine, shared her cravings and joked about her excess of amniotic fluid on “Jimmy Kimmel Live.”

Maxwell is the first child for 31-year-old Simpson and her 32-year-old fiance Eric Johnson, a former NFL player.

The name is a tribute to the couple’s families: Maxwell is Johnson’s middle name and the maiden name of his mother, and Drew is Simpson’s mother’s maiden name.

Family, friends remember late Wallace

Chris Wallace turned and blew a kiss to a giant portrait of his father, “60 Minutes” journalist Mike Wallace, after memorializing him Tuesday as “the best journalist I have ever known.”

Former colleagues, friends and family members swapped stories about Wallace in an auditorium a few blocks from where he worked. Mike Wallace died at age 93 on April 7.

Some of the stories were flattering, some less so. “Let’s be honest, at some point in time not just Morley (Safer), not just Ed (Bradley), many people in this room were not speaking to my father,” Chris Wallace said.

Beatle’s widow releases digital book

George Harrison’s widow Olivia hopes to add more perspective on the reticent Beatle with her new digital book, and fill in the blanks left by Martin Scorsese’s recent documentary.

Based on Scorsese’s “George Harrison: Living in the Material World,” the multitouch book of the same name is available Tuesday at the iTunes bookstore.

In a telephone interview from London, Olivia Harrison, who served as one of the film’s producers, said she loved the message of the film, but felt it didn’t cover her husband’s other “sides.”

“Marty chose the music for the narrative and it drives the story. I think he fit the music perfectly in there, but there’s was a point when I realized, ‘Oh wow, we’re not going to get past 1975,’ ” Harrison said. She noted the absence of the song “Taxman” and his 1987 comeback album, “Cloud Nine.”
